This is why no self-respecting group that holds meetings can survive without owning at least one Coffee Maker Urn. These are the tall metal vessels you see at all meetings. They have a spigot on the lower part and a lid on the top. These incredible machines are time tested and required equipment to keep your guests from leaving the meeting early.

The first feature you need to select before buying one of these is the size of the urn. The size of the urn dictates the number of cups of coffee it can serve. If you have meetings where at most you will need 40 cups of coffee then you can buy an urn that serves 20-40 cups. But if you have some meetings that will need 20 cups and other meetings that will need 100 cups, then you need to buy one that has a 20-100 cup range.
Other features in a coffee maker urn include exterior gauges that show the number of cups left in the urn, varying speeds at which the urn brews coffee, drip free spigots, and the availability of automatic warming settings where the urn itself keeps track of the internal coffee temperature and makes adjustments to keep it warm. There are also urns that have the availability of multiple attachments such as little baskets for coffee supplies and cup holders to keep the stack of cups neatly organized. There are also coffee maker urns that have unique brewing systems that allow for easier cleaning after the meeting.
